Used Oil Collection for Food Processing Plants

Food and dairy plants run large ammonia refrigeration systems, and compressor oil is the dominant stream. The critical point in this sector is segregation: used lubricating oil and used cooking oil are entirely different waste streams with different rules, and mixing them creates a compliance problem.

Oil streams from a food processing plant

Each stream is lifted and manifested separately where it is stored separately. Segregated oil is worth more than a mixed drum — to you and to us.

❄️
Ammonia compressor oil
Refrigeration and cold storage compressors. The largest stream in most food plants.
⚙️
Gearbox & drive oil
Conveyors, homogenisers, separators, filling and packing lines.
🛢️
Hydraulic oil
Palletisers, case packers, presses and material handling.
🔌
DG set oil
Standby generation protecting the cold chain.
Transformer oil
Plant substation transformers.

Indicative ex-works band
₹38–50/litre

Indicative only. The actual price depends on quantity, water and solids content, segregation, packing and distance. We test before we quote rather than after we lift.

Procurement route

Typically an annual contract with an authorized vendor, managed by the plant's engineering or EHS function. Food-safety audits mean vendor documentation is scrutinised closely.

Food Processing — frequently asked

Is used cooking oil the same as used lubricating oil?

No, and they must never be mixed. Used cooking oil goes to the biodiesel or UCO route under FSSAI's RUCO framework; used lubricating oil is hazardous waste under Category 5.1. We handle used lubricating oil.

What is the largest oil stream in a food plant?

Ammonia refrigeration compressor oil, in almost every case. Cold storage and freezing capacity drives the volume.

Does collection interfere with food-safety zoning?

No. Lifting is arranged from the utility or engineering block, away from production and packing areas, at a time the plant nominates.

Can you support our food-safety audit documentation?

Yes. We provide the Form-10 manifest chain plus our CPCB and RPCB authorizations, ISO 9001, 14001 and 45001 certificates for the vendor file.

Do you lift from cold storage facilities as well as plants?

Yes. Standalone cold stores run substantial ammonia compressor fleets and are good collection points, particularly grouped on a route.
